Expensive appliances and attractive colors are not enough to make your kitchen look beautiful. A proper and correct lighting is required to accomplish the total look and feel.

Suppose you desire to have a candle-lit dinner with your loved one. A dim light will serve the purpose to bring the cozy effect. What if you throw a party? You invite your friends over for dinner. You would obviously need brightly lit lamps to illuminate the whole atmosphere of the kitchen. So, what we are talking of here is a combination of both dim and shiny lights.

Pendants, accents, fluorescent, ambient and decorative are the main forms of kitchen lightings. It all depends on the type that your kitchen demands. It often happens that you sit on the kitchen countertop to do some work on your laptop. For this you need good lighting which will help to keep your eyes healthy.
